Dollars And Sense by Dan Ariely
How We Misthink Money and How to Spend Smarter
This lively behavioral-economics book uses experiments and real-world examples to reveal how predictable cognitive biases — like anchoring, loss aversion, mental accounting, the pain of paying, and present bias — lead people to make poor financial choices; it explains why we misjudge value, fall for irrelevant comparisons, procrastinate on saving, and overpay without realizing it, and it offers practical strategies and nudges to simplify decisions, align spending with priorities, and make smarter, more consistent money choices.
